Tetrarhanis ilala is a butterfly in the Lycaenidae family. It is found in Cameroon, Gabon, the Republic of the Congo, the Central African Republic, the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Sudan, Uganda and Kenya.[2] The habitat consists of primary forests.
Subspecies
- Tetrarhanis ilala ilala (southern Sudan, Uganda, western Kenya)
- Tetrarhanis ilala etoumbi (Stempffer, 1964) (Cameroon, Gabon, Congo, Central African Republic, Democratic Republic of the Congo)
